Liberty City
Suburban Neighborhood in Savannah, Georgia
Chatham County 31405
Retail and restaurants nearby
Grab groceries and other everyday essentials at the corner of Liberty Parkway and Ogeechee Road, where there’s a Red & White Foods and a Family Dollar. Both stores are less than a mile from most Liberty City homes. There are lots of shopping and dining options on Abercorn Street, too, a little farther afield at about 4 miles from most homes. The bustling main thoroughfare is home to grocery stores like The Fresh Market and Publix, as well as clothing retailers like J. Crew Factory and Jos A. Bank. Near Publix, there’s also Bonefish Grill and OAK 36 Bar & Kitchen for when the itinerary calls for a meal out. For a brewski, locals don’t need to venture even that far, though, with Coastal Empire Beer Company off Nettles Road in the heart of the neighborhood. Stops along Chatham Area Transit, or CAT, bus lines are scattered throughout Liberty City. Most are stationed at intervals on main thoroughfares like Mills B Lane Boulevard and Liberty Parkway. Interstate 516 runs along the neighborhood’s south and west sides. There’s an eclectic array of homes here, from midcentury ranch-style homes and classic 1970s Split Levels to 1980s Colonial Revivals and even Craftsman-inspired and Traditional-style new construction. Prices for these single-family homes are just as varied, ranging anywhere from $97,000 for a three-bedroom bungalow in need of cosmetic repair and updates to more than $425,000 for a four-bedroom Traditional-style new build. Off Mills B Lane Boulevard, the local rec center offers tons of opportunities for fun and movement both indoors and out. There’s a playground, a picnic pavilion and a paved trail around the little lake out back for when the weather’s nice. But on rainy days or when it’s too hot to enjoy the sunshine, head inside and take advantage of the center’s full sports complex. There’s everything from a gymnasium and fitness room to a computer lab and meeting rooms, where locals can enjoy programs like the weekly Coffee & Conversation get-togethers or craft and dance classes. Across Mills B Lane Boulevard from the community center, Laney Contemporary Fine Art has showcased emerging and established artists from Savannah and around the world since 2017. Liberty City youngsters go to Butler or Hodge Elementary and Derenne Middle between preschool and eighth grade. In 2024, both Butler and Derenne earned C-minuses from Niche. Hodge earned a C. Older students go to Beach High, which also earned a C from Niche. Beach High is one of only two schools in the district to offer a Medical and Allied Health magnet program. Teens from across the two counties can apply to participate in the program and attend the school regardless of their home address.

On average, homes in Liberty City, Savannah sell after 103 days on the market compared to the national average of 48 days. The median sale price for homes in Liberty City, Savannah over the last 12 months is $230,000, down 2% from the average home sale price over the previous 12 months.
